The DC Water's Biosolids Management Program

Joint Meeting with the American Water Resources Association, National Capital Region

Brent Christ, Construction Supervisor for DC Water

Dave Schwartz, Project Manager for PC/CDM Joint Venture

Peter Loomis, Design Manager for CDM Smith

The Blue Plains Advanced Wastewater Treatment Plant is the largest advanced wastewater plant in the world.  Its peak treatment capacity exceeds 1 billion gallons per day, serving over 2 million residents of Washington DC, Maryland, and Virginia.  DC Water is currently implementing a ten-year, $3.8 billion Capital Improvement Program, which aims to improve the District’s water and sewer infrastructure.  One major component of this is the Biosolids Management Program (BMP), which focuses on the reduction of biosolids volume and its treatment for regulatory use. 

The Main Process Train (MPT) is one of four main projects of the BMP, and was awarded in 2011 to the joint venture of CDM Smith and PC Construction as a Design-Build delivery and has a contract amount exceeding $208 million.  The MPT will involve the implementation of thermal hydrolysis technology and anaerobic digestion at Blue Plains to significantly reduce biosolids hauling and disposal, increase biogas production, and improve the facility's future sustainability.

The presentation will have three distinguished speakers: Brent Christ is the Construction Supervisor for DC Water and will provide insight on the project's background and its drivers; Dave Schwartz, VP of CDM Smith and Project Manager for the PC/CDM Joint Venture, will discuss the design-build process; and Peter Loomis, also of CDM Smith, and design manager for the MPT project, will discuss technical aspects of the project.
